Wiktionary
PORTULACA, noun. Any of many tropical trailing herbs, of the genus Portulaca, having showy flowers
PORTULACA, proper noun. A taxonomic genus within the family Portulacaceae — the portulacas or purslanes.
PORTULACA OLERACEA, proper noun. A taxonomic species within the family Portulacaceae — common purslane.
Dictionary definition
PORTULACA, noun. A plant of the genus Portulaca having pink or red or purple or white ephemeral flowers.
